A method for configuring a programmable logic controller (PLC) having a
protocol is provided. The method includes providing an extensible markup
language (XML) schema for the protocol of the PLC. In another aspect, a
method for configuring a programmable logic controller (PLC) having a
protocol includes utilizing the schema to validate at least one XML file
parsed from a comma separated variable (CSV) file created by a
configuration tool for a protocol different than the protocol of the PLC.
In another aspect, a method for configuring a programmable logic
controller (PLC) having a protocol includes utilizing the schema to
validate at least one XML file parsed from a comma separated variable
(CSV) file created by a configuration tool.